Portuguese
Pronunciation
- (Brazil) IPA(key): /biˈa.tɐ/ [bɪˈa.tɐ], (faster pronunciation) /ˈbja.tɐ/
- (Southern Brazil) IPA(key): /biˈa.ta/ [bɪˈa.ta], (faster pronunciation) /ˈbja.ta/
- (Portugal) IPA(key): /ˈbja.tɐ/
- Rhymes: -atɐ
- Hyphenation: be‧a‧ta
Etymology 1
Unknown.
Noun
beata f (plural beatas)
- (colloquial) butt, stub (of a cigarette)
- Synonyms: prisca, bituca
- 2017 December 1, “Retiraram 50 mil beatas do chão e areia de Setúbal”, in Shifter:
- Numa campanha inédita um grupo de voluntários, da cidade de Setúbal, recolheu, ao longo de 9 acções em diferentes locais, 53 032 beatas. Os números, a que dificilmente se atribui um peso estatístico, são uma útil chamada de atenção para todos os fumadores com o mau hábito de atirar a beata para o chão.
